Key Risks
- •Trophy asset liquidity constraints in correction cycles
- •Narrow buyer pool for ultra-prime dispositions
- •Maintenance and presentation costs for prestige holdings
- •Geopolitical sensitivity affecting UHNW capital flows
- •Ultra-prime niche with limited exit liquidity
Regulatory Framework
- ✓All freehold acquisitions governed by Dubai Land Department (DLD) registration
- ✓Service charge regulated by RERA (Real Estate Regulatory Agency)
- ✓Penthouse classified under DLD property categorisation framework
- ✓Rental income subject to Ejari tenancy registration requirements
